Scientific Study from the year 2016 in the subject Biology - Micro- and Molecular Biology, grade: 1.5, Mar Augusthinose College, language: English, abstract: Citrus, one of the major genes of Rutaceae family and most economically important fruit tree and widely cultivated throughout the country. The Citrus have high nutritional value and medicinal value. The three varieties obtained from various districts in Kerala were used in this study. The phylogenetics is the study of the evolutionary relationships among different species which have common ancestor. These relationships are shown in the form of phylogenetic trees composed of branches which indicate the descendents and nodes which represent the most recent common ancestors. In order to assess the phylogenetic relationships among the 6 samples belongs to the 3 Citrus species (Citrus aurantifolia, Citrus maxima, Citrus limon) a chloroplast gene rbcL and matK was successfully amplified and sequenced. For this study DNA was extracted by using CTAB method. This extracted DNA was analysed by spectrophotometry method for checking purity of DNA.The samples were gel electrophoresed by 1% agarose gel electrophoresis at 80 volts. After electrophoresis the gel is examined in gel documentation system. The DNA band was observed under UV light looking florescent Orangish red colour. The extracted DNA was amplified by PCR method and PCR sample was applied for electrophoresis for checking DNA bands. PCR sample were purified sent for sequencing. Sequences obtained were subjected to editing and alignment using ClustalW programme of Bio Edit and phylogenetic analysis was performed using MEGA software. High similarity observed between selected verities. The locally collected gene sequence-based phylogeny presented here provides support for the early studies of speciation within the Rutaceae. An understanding of the main phylogenetic relationships between Citrus species will help to fine-tune the taxonomy of Rutaceae.

Scientific Study from the year 2017 in the subject Biology - Genetics / Gene Technology, Mar Augusthinose College, language: English, abstract: Artocarpus heterophyllus belong to the Moraceae family and are abundant in Western Ghats. The fruit provide two MJ per kg/wet weight of ripe perianth and contain high levels of carbohydrates, protein, starch, calcium and vitamins. Jackfruit has diverse medicinal uses especially for anti-oxidant, anti-inflammatory, antimicrobial, anti-cancer and anti-fungal activity. MatK (maturase K) genes are fast evolving, highly variant regions of plant chloroplast DNA that can serve as potential biomarkers for DNA coding and also in generating primers for plants with identification of unique motif regions. Advances in the genetic markers such as RFLP and PCR based methods are more reliable for identification of genetic diversity than morphological markers, although each technique has advantages and limitations. The objective of this research work was to estimate the level of genetic diversity and to assess genetic relationships among six varieties of jackfruit using ‘matK gene’ based on PCR technique and RFLP markers. The partial sequence of the ‘matK’ gene of six different Artocarpus varities was used in the analysis. The size of amplified products was approximately 700 bp. After sequencing and sequence editing, sequence information on a 674 bp region was finally obtained for analysis. The alignment of sequences revealed two haplotypes out of 674 sites. The nucleotide frequencies are 30.00% (A), 37.69% (T/U), 17.93% (C), and 14.39% (G). Being one of the underutilized fruits in India, Artocarpus heterophyllus Lam. has promising leads to further scientific researches and livelihood strategies. The study of matK gene using PCR and RFLP seems to a promising tool in establishing genetic diversity among jackfruit varities. The tree, indigenous to the Western Ghats, is an important source of nutritious food during summer season. Encouragements should be made to the marketing as well as value added food products from this underutilized fruit tree.

Sweet potato (Ipomoea batatas Lam.) is the seventh most important food crop among the root and tuber crops grown in the world which is widely cultivated in tropic, sub tropic and warmer temperate regions. A wide variation exists among sweet potato varieties. The molecular markers Is an important genetic diversity analysis tool for enhancing duplicates identification. The samples were collected based on an elaborative iterative survey as well as traditional knowledge from local people. Thirteen different varieties Ipomoea batatas Lam. varieties (Kuravanpady 1, Kuravanpady 2, Jellipara 1, Jellipara 2, Kottathara, Kadanadu, Kanaka, Aruna, Kanjagad, Cherukizhangu 1, Cherukizhangu 2, Thodupuzha. Palakkad) were used for morphological characterization. Morphological data were collected 60 days after planting based on the descriptors for sweet potato (IBPGR, 1991) in all the 13 samples. The variable scored were twining, plant type, ground cover, vine inter node, vine pigmentation, vine tip pubescence, mature leaf shape, mature leaf size, abaxial leaf vein pigmentation, foliage colour, petiole length, petiole pigmentation, storage root and skin colour. Molecular characterization could be more effectively used in screening varieties among sweet potatoes if coupled with other molecular markers especially ISSR, matK and rbcL markers.

Scientific Study from the year 2016 in the subject Biology - Genetics / Gene Technology, Mar Augusthinose College, language: English, abstract: Jackfruit (Artocarpus heterophyllus) is commonly grown in home gardens of tropical and sub-tropical countries. The fruit contains high levels of carbohydrates, protein, starch, calcium and vitamins. Jack fruit has diverse medicinal uses, especially anti-oxidant, anti-inflammatory, anti-microbial, anti-cancer and anti-fungal activity. Jackfruit is considered to be an underutilized fruit where most of the fruits get wasted due to ignorance, lack of post harvest technology and gaps in supply chain systems. Jackfruit contains more protein, calcium, iron, vitamins and other essential nutrients as compared to the common fruits. To find out the morphological variation among jack fruits among Kerala we conducted an elaborative survey and found out the parameters such as tree characteristics, leaf characterises or fruit characteristics of selected samples. Both qualitative and quantitative data are measured using field visits and standard methods and morphological indicators; after analysis of data there is a morphological variation among the jack fruit samples identified. Advances in the genetic markers such as RFLP and PCR based methods are more reliable for identification of genetic diversity than morphological markers although each technique has advantages and limitations. The objective of this research work was to estimate the level of genetic diversity and to assess genetic relationships among six varieties of jackfruit using the ‘rbcL gene’ based on PCR technique and RFLP markers. The partial sequence of ‘rbcL’ gene of six different Artocarpus varieties was used in the analysis. The size of amplified products was approximately 700 bp. After sequencing and sequence editing, sequence information on a 651 bp region was finally obtained for analysis. The alignment of sequences revealed two haplotypes out of 651 sites. The nucleotide frequencies are 27.96% (A), 29.47% (T/U), 19.69% (C), and 22.89% (G). Being one of the underutilized fruits in India, Artocarpus heterophyllus Lam has promising leads to further scientific research and livelihood strategies. The study of rbcL gene using PCR and RFLP seems to be a promising tool in establishing genetic diversity among jackfruit varieties.

Tea is an important non-alcoholic beverage plant of the world. Cultivation of tea is very important as it earns revenue for the tea growing nations especially the developing countries such as India. Although conventional breeding is well-established and has contributed significantly for varietal improvement of this plant and other Camellia species with ornamental value, yet applications of biotechnology are required to intervene some of the issues where conventional breeding is restricted particularly for woody plants such as tea. It is note-worthy to mention that some amounts of biotechnology works in several facets of tea and its wild species have also been done. In the present book, a state-of-the-art on various aspects of breeding and biotechnology has been complied in eight chapters. They are: i) Origin and descriptions of health benefits as well as morphological classification as first chapter, ii) Breeding and cytogenetics that comprise with various conventional approaches of varietal improvement of tea along with their genetic resources, iii) Micropropagation which deals with in-depth study of clonal propagation, iv) Somatic embryogenesis along with alternative techniques such as suspension culture, cry-preservation etc. v) Molecular breeding that deals with application of various DNA-based markers, linkage map etc., vi) Genetic transformation and associated factors, vii) Stress physiology complied with various works done in tea along with its wild relatives on abiotic as well as biotic stress, and viii) Functional genomics that describe the various works of molecular cloning and characterizations, differential gene expression, high-throughput sequencing, bioinformatics etc. Importantly, the author has made exclusive tables in most of the chapters that include the summary of the works in particular topic. In a nutshell, the book compiles the work already been done, identifies the problems, analyzes the gaps on breeding and biotechnological works of tea as well as its wild species and discusses the future scope as conclusion.
